Rotor parallelism refers to the condition when there are variation in thickness of the rotor from one point of measurement to another point of measurement around the rotor surface. But with poorer quality brake pads, the deposits of friction material can stick to the rotor unevenly, changing the rotor's thickness and parallelism.
